WebFeb 3, 2012 · The SoilWeb app is a portable version of the UC Davis California Soil Resource Lab ’s Web-based interface to digital soil survey data from USDA’s Natural Resources Conservation Service (NRCS) . Because the app provides soil survey information in a mobile form, it is particularly useful for those working in the field. WebApr 12, 2024 · Web Soil Survey (WSS) provides soil data and information produced by the National Cooperative Soil Survey. It is operated by the USDA Natural Resources Conservation Service. NRCS has soil maps and data available online for more than 95 percent of the nation’s counties. WebSoil survey, soil mapping, is the process of classifying soil types and other soil properties in a given area and geo-encoding such information. It applies the principles of soil science, and draws heavily from geomorphology, theories of soil formation, physical geography, and analysis of vegetation and land use patterns. Primary data for the soil survey are acquired … WebA soil survey is the systematic description, classification, and mapping of soils in an area. WebThe Web Soil Survey (WSS) is a web-based soil survey developed and operated by the USDA—NRCS (Natural Resources Conservation Services). It provides information about the inherent characteristics of the native soil types (or series) at a specific location. WebJul 31, 2024 · NRCS has soil maps and data available online for more than 95 percent of the nation’s counties and anticipates having 100 percent in the near future. The site is updated and maintained online as the single authoritative source of soil survey information. Soil surveys can be used for general farm, local, and wider area planning.
